Chimichurri Grilled Chicken Bowl with Garlic Sauce

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 2 servings

Description

This Chimichurri Grilled Chicken Bowl with Garlic Sauce layers vibrant flavor on every level. Juicy grilled chicken marinated in herby chimichurri, topped with a garlicky creamy sauce, and paired with a fresh pico de gallo — all served over greens or rice for a hearty, zesty, and satisfying meal. Perfect for lunch, dinner, or weekly meal prep.


Ingredients

2 chicken breasts

1 cup fresh parsley, finely chopped

1 cup fresh cilantro, finely chopped

4 garlic cloves, minced

3 tablespoons red wine vinegar

1/2 teaspoon red chili flakes

1/2 cup olive oil

1/2 cup Greek yogurt or mayonnaise

2 tablespoons lemon juice

2 Roma tomatoes, diced

1/4 red onion, finely diced

salt and pepper to taste

2 cups mixed greens or cooked rice


Instructions

1. In a bowl or food processor, mix parsley, cilantro, 2 cloves garlic, red wine vinegar, chili flakes, olive oil, salt, and pepper to form chimichurri.

2. Coat chicken breasts with half of the chimichurri. Marinate in the fridge for 30 minutes to 1 hour.

3. Grill the chicken over medium-high heat for 5–7 minutes per side until cooked and charred. Let rest, then slice.

4. In a small bowl, combine yogurt or mayo, 2 cloves grated garlic, lemon juice, olive oil, salt, and pepper to create the garlic sauce.

5. Mix diced tomatoes and red onion with a splash of lemon juice and a pinch of salt for a quick pico de gallo.

6. In a bowl, layer greens or rice. Top with sliced chicken, a spoon of pico, drizzle remaining chimichurri, and add garlic sauce.

Notes

Use a mix of parsley and cilantro for balanced freshness in the chimichurri.

Let the chicken rest before slicing to retain juiciness.

Store leftover sauces in airtight containers for up to 1 week.
